Zhu J, Wang D, Liu C, Huang R, Gao F, Feng X, Lan T, Li H, Wu H. Development and validation of a new prognostic immune–inflammatory–nutritional score for predicting outcomes after curative resection for intrahepatic cholangiocarcinoma: A multicenter study. Front Immunol 2023; 14:1165510. [PMID: 37063918 PMCID: PMC10102611 DOI: 10.3389/fimmu.2023.1165510] [Citation(s) in RCA: 8] [Impact Index Per Article: 8.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/14/2023] [Accepted: 03/21/2023] [Indexed: 04/03/2023] Open
Abstract
BackgroundImmune function, nutrition status, and inflammation influence tumor initiation and progression. This was a retrospective multicenter cohort study that investigated the prognostic value and clinical relevance of immune-, inflammatory-, and nutritional-related biomarkers to develop a novel prognostic immune–inflammatory–nutritional score (PIIN score) for patients with intrahepatic cholangiocarcinoma (ICC).MethodsThe clinical data of 571 patients (406 in the training set and 165 in the validation set) were collected from four large hepato-pancreatico-biliary centers of patients with ICC who underwent surgical resection between January 2011 and September 2017. Twelve blood biomarkers were collected to develop the PIIN score using the LASSO Cox regression model. The predictive value was further assessed using validation datasets. Afterward, nomograms combining the PIIN score and other clinicopathological parameters were developed and validated based on the calibration curve, time-dependent AUC curves, and decision curve analysis (DCA). The primary outcomes evaluated were overall survival (OS) and recurrence-free survival (RFS) from the day of primary resection of ICC.ResultsBased on the albumin–bilirubin (ALBI) grade, neutrophil- to- lymphocyte ratio (NLR), prognostic nutritional index (PNI), and systemic immune- inflammation index (SII) biomarkers, the PIIN score that classified patients into high-risk and low-risk groups could be calculated. Patients with high-risk scores had shorter OS (training set, p < 0.001; validation set, p = 0.003) and RFS (training set, p < 0.001; validation set, p = 0.002) than patients with low-risk scores. The high PIIN score was also associated with larger tumors (≥5 cm), lymph node metastasis (N1 stage), multiple tumors, and high tumor grade or TNM (tumor (T), nodes (N), and metastases (M)) stage. Furthermore, the high PIIN score was a significant independent prognostic factor of OS and RFS in both the training (p < 0.001) and validation (p = 0.003) cohorts, respectively. A PIIN-nomogram for individualized prognostic prediction was constructed by integrating the PIIN score with the clinicopathological variables that yielded better predictive performance than the TNM stage.ConclusionThe PIIN score, a novel immune–inflammatory–nutritional-related prognostic biomarker, predicts the prognosis in patients with resected ICC and can be a reliable tool for ICC prognosis prediction after surgery. Our study findings provide novel insights into the role of cancer-related immune disorders, inflammation, and malnutrition.

Huang T, Kong J, Liu H, Lin Z, Lin Q, Lou J, Zheng S, Bi X, Wang J, Guo W, Li F, Wang J, Zheng Y, Li J, Cheng S, Zhou W, Zeng Y. Dynamic evaluation of postoperative survival in intrahepatic cholangiocarcinoma patients who did not undergo lymphadenectomy: a multicenter study. Scand J Gastroenterol 2023; 58:178-184. [PMID: 36036215 DOI: 10.1080/00365521.2022.2113426]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
BACKGROUND The prognosis of Intrahepatic cholangiocarcinoma (ICC) patients who did not undergo lymphadenectomy is difficult to assess. This study aims to have a dynamic evaluation on the postoperative survival of ICC patients by calculating conditional survival. METHODS Relevant data were from patients treated in 12 large-scale hospitals from December 2011 to December 2017. The influence of relevant clinical baseline data on the prognosis of ICC patients was analyzed by Cox regression. Conditional survival (CS) is a method that may predict the prognostic probability dynamically. For a patient with x years of survival, the 1-year CS (CS1) may be calculated as CS1= OS(x + 1)/OS(x). RESULT A total of 361 patients who met the criteria were included in the study. Conditional survival (CS) means that the patients' prognosis varies with survival time, meanwhile, relevant factors affecting the prognosis have a time-varying effect. The probability of survival assessed by CS1 increased year by year and the 1,2,3-year survival improved from 68.4% to 87.8%, while the postoperative actuarial OS decreased from 69.4% at 1 years to 36.9% at 3 years. CONCLUSIONS In terms of CS, the estimated survival for ICC varies with the increase of survival time after excision. Patients who live longer were likely to live longer. At the same time, with the passage of time, the role of the original adverse factors of the tumor would gradually decrease. Conditional survival allows a more accurate assessment of ICC patients who did not undergo lymphadenectomy.
